Americans Are Less Optimistic About Their Finances

In a recent study by Bankrate, 55% of Americans said they do not think their personal finances will improve in 2019. 

A second study found that only 40% of Americans could pay an unexpected expense of $1,000 from their own savings. So reports Financial Advisor.

The sorry state of many Americans’ finances is likely to have contributed to the lack of optimism regarding 2019.
